If you are considering modding the car SC'ing should be considered. If you decide to go the N/A path to achieving high hp numbers with Cam, Headwork, Headers, Intake, etc, etc, in the end you will most likely have pretty close to the same amount of money tied up. The nice thing about a SC setup is should you decide to sell you can always reverse the install and sell the SC kit for a good price. When going for internal mods for performance you are really hurting any future resale value of the car, and loosing all your mod money.
